                           JUDGMENT

The grievance of the petitioner in the writ petition

concerns the seniority of the part bill raised in respect of a

work which is being executed by the petitioner as a

contractor. It is alleged by the petitioner in the writ petition

that on account of a defect in the bill which is not attributable

to the petitioner, he is likely to lose the seniority of the bill.

2. The learned Government Pleader, on

instructions, submits that the seniority of the bill of the

petitioner referred to in the writ petition will not be affected

on account of the defect pointed out.

In the circumstances, the writ petition is closed

recording the submission made by the learned Government

Pleader.
